About The Position

The Occupational Therapy Student Aide helps prepare patients and the environment for treatments and assists therapists in performing treatment under his/her supervision. This position requires providing service to the following age population(s) pediatric, adolescent, adult, older adult and frail elderly in a manner that demonstrates an understanding of the functional/developmental age of the individual served.

Requirements

  • Must be currently enrolled in an OT program.
  • High School diploma or equivalent required.
  • Patient care related experience strongly preferred.
  • BLS, CPR Certification Required through the AHA.
